Costs and Efficiency:

When it comes to price and running costs, the biggest differences usually appear. This is often where you see which car fits your budget better in the long run.

VW T-Cross has a evident advantage in terms of price – it starts at 21400 £ , while the Kia Niro costs 29100 £ . That’s a price difference of around 7740 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: Kia Niro manages with 2.40 L and is therefore decisively more efficient than the VW T-Cross with 5.40 L. The difference is about 3 L per 100 km.

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.

When it comes to engine power, the Kia Niro has a slightly edge – offering 180 HP compared to 150 HP. That’s roughly 30 HP more horsepower.

In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the VW T-Cross is slightly quicker – completing the sprint in 8.40 s, while the Kia Niro takes 9.90 s. That’s about 1.50 s faster.

There’s also a difference in torque: Kia Niro pulls minimal stronger with 265 Nm compared to 250 Nm. That’s about 15 Nm difference.

Space and Everyday Use:

Cabin size, boot volume and payload all play a role in everyday practicality. Here, comfort and flexibility make the difference.

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.

In curb weight, VW T-Cross is a bit lighter – 1267 kg compared to 1474 kg. The difference is around 207 kg.

In terms of boot space, the VW T-Cross offers slight more room – 455 L compared to 451 L. That’s a difference of about 4 L.

When it comes to payload, VW T-Cross barely noticeable takes the win – 480 kg compared to 466 kg. That’s a difference of about 14 kg.

The Kia Niro blends clever packaging and modern styling into a compact crossover that’s refreshingly sensible for daily life. It’s comfortable, economical and packed with user‑friendly tech, so if you want a fuss‑free family car with a touch of green credibility, the Niro is worth a test drive.

The VW T-Cross turns everyday practicality into a style statement, offering a roomy-feeling cabin, clever storage and playful design that suits town life and family duties alike. On the road it's composed and relaxed, rewarding buyers who want the raised seating and confident presence of an SUV without the weighty compromises.
